Carbon neutral is the hot ticket in filming these days, kicked off with “Syriana,” “The Day After Tomorrow,” and “There Will be Blood,” to name a few. After the credits roll, they typically give credit to the production being 100 percent carbon neutral.
This is definitely a process where strong math skills will come in handy. First, consultants measure the carbon dioxide output that is estimated to be used during a production, then methods are used to cut energy consumption and usage during a production. This includes flights, driving hybrids or using bio-diesel, electricity conservation methods, and recycling. Even using locally grown organic food for catering can add to the equation.
